What Are Nostalgic Fashion Reels?

Nostalgic fashion reels are short-form videos that tap into the powerful emotional pull of past decades, blending vintage aesthetics, retro styling, and throwback cultural moments with modern outfit content. From 90s grunge and Y2K butterfly tops to 70s disco glam and early 2000s denim, these reels let creators relive fashion history while staying firmly on trend.

On T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ts, nostalgic content consistently outperforms generic outfit posts. The reason is simple: viewers crave emotional connection, and few things trigger that faster than a perfectly recreated look from their childhood or teen years. How to Make Nostalgic Fashion Reels That Go Viral

1. Pick the Right Era and Aesthetic

Choose a decade or subculture that aligns with your audience. Gen Z is obsessed with Y2K, millennials lean into 90s minimalism, and a growing wave is reviving 70s boho. The clearer your era, the stronger the visual story.

2. Use a Strong Throwback Hook

Open your reel with a recognizable trigger: a vintage TV static effect, a Polaroid transition, a film grain overlay, or a "then vs now" side-by-side. The first two seconds decide whether someone keeps watching.

3. Pair the Outfit With Period-Accurate Sound

Music is half the nostalgia. Use trending throwback audio, original-era hits, or slowed and reverbed versions of classic tracks. TikTok's algorithm rewards sound selection, so choose tracks already gaining traction in retro niches.

4. Add Authentic Texture and Color Grading

Edit your reel with VHS overlays, faded film tones, warm sepia, or Kodak-style filters. Small editing choices signal "this is a memory" to the viewer, even if the outfit is brand new.

5. Tell a Mini Story

Skip the static try-on. Build a quick narrative: getting ready in a bedroom that looks like 2003, walking through a roller rink, posing at a vintage car. Story-driven reels get rewatched, and rewatch rate is one of the strongest ranking signals on every short-form platform.

Platform-Specific Strategies for Nostalgic Fashion Reels

TikTok

Lean into "Get Ready With Me" formats, era-specific transformations, and duet bait like "POV you found your mom's old wardrobe." Hashtags such as #Y2KFashion, #90sStyle, and #ThrowbackFit perform well, but pair them with broader tags like #FashionTok to expand reach.

Instagram Reels

Instagram rewards polished aesthetics and saves. Carousel-style reel covers work beautifully for nostalgic fashion reels because the thumbnail alone can transport a viewer. Use location tags to vintage shops and museums to tap into explore page discovery.

YouTube Shorts

Shorts viewers often search by topic rather than hashtag. Optimize your title and description with phrases like "90s fall outfits," "2000s party look," or "70s street style remake." YouTube also rewards longer watch time within shorts, so aim for a 45 to 60 second runtime with a strong payoff at the end.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Costume vibes without context: Wearing a costume without a nostalgic setting or music feels hollow. Always build a world around the look.Ignoring modern fit: Modern sizing and proportions matter. Adapt vintage silhouettes so they flatter today's body shapes.Over-editing: Too many transitions break the dreamy, memory-like feel that makes nostalgia work.Skipping the hook: A nostalgic reel still needs a strong opening frame, just like any other short-form video.
